Known PDA problems
Two known PDA problems are described below:
•
The cache is full after some time.
The Web browsers of some PDAs have the unwanted tendency to store more
and more data in the cache as time goes on without releasing the memory
again. As a result, the Web browser no longer runs.
•
If you click the "Close" button, the Web browser is removed from the screen of
some PDAs but continues to run in the background. In conjunction with the first
problem explained above, this soon leads to memory overflow.
You can counter these problems with the measures described below. Follow the
order of steps below and following each step, check whether the memory used has
been released again. If it is released, the remaining steps are unnecessary.
1. Exit the Web browser as follows: Start > Settings > "System" tab > Memory >
"Running Programs" tab, select "Internet Explorer" and click on the "Stop".
2. Internet Explorer: Tools > Options... > "Memory" tab, click on the "Delete Files"
button.
3. Turn the PDA off.
4. Run a soft reset on the PDA (usually by pressing a hidden button with a pen or
similar).
5. Run a hard reset on the PDA.
